RMR Wealth Builders's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2023, RMR Wealth Builders held 224 positions worth $588M, up 12% from $526M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 56% of the portfolio.
RMR Wealth Builders deployed $45.9M of net new capital in Q2 2023, opening 12 new positions and adding to 108 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Vanguard Mid-Cap Growth ETF: 68,424 shares worth $92.4K.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 11% of assets, up from 10%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ares 1-3 Year Treasury Bond ETF, an estimated $2.2M trimmed.
